Order filler vs order checker

The differences between order fillers and order checkers can be seen in a few details. Each job has different responsibilities and duties. Additionally, an order filler has an average salary of $31,551, which is higher than the $28,321 average annual salary of an order checker.

The top three skills for an order filler include pallets, electric pallet jack and safety standards. The most important skills for an order checker are basic math, pallets, and customer orders.

Differences between order filler and order checker duties and responsibilities

Order filler example responsibilities.

  • Used WMS and RF systems to pick and stage customer specify orders and lead a team of employees.
  • License to drive a stand-up forklift, stand-up clamp forklift, PE lift, and CR lift.
  • Fulfill store orders by loading pallets using a hand-operate forklift for merchandise distribution in different locations.
  • Train in NSF and MSDS.
  • Use VoCollect selection equipment to pick correct product quantities.
  • Utilize both tablet base computer interface and RF hand scanner.

Order checker example responsibilities.

  • Used WMS and RF systems to pick and stage customer specify orders and lead a team of employees.
  • Stack, wrap and label pallets correctly for each customer to ensure proper routing.
  • Labele, bundle, arrange pallets, and transport to loading docks via forklift.
  • Coordinate logistics with freight forwarders for international customers and follow through with products reaching their final destination.
  • Pick and pack orders, ship orders using the FedEx shipping system, receive and verify shipments, stock shelves
